Pelican Art Gallery Celebrates 1 year Downtown

Pelican Art Gallery has a special show for our first anniversary in our downtown location and this holiday season. The show, “LA to Abstracts: Spectrum of Art” truly spans a wide variety of art medium, style and budget.

This show includes something for everyone! Our abstracts are creations from Kathryn Graham Wilson, owner of Cats & Dragons Art Studio. Kathryn’s abstract paintings are so full of life and color. We anchored the show with Kathryn’s art and the playful southern California paintings of Terrence Howell. Howell presents light retro paintings with flamingos, swimming pools and the atmosphere of a lazy summer afternoon in the Los Angeles area. The other artists include stunningly beautiful gourds by Peggy Palletti (German artist), one-of a kind fleeced scarves by Muriel Knapp, soft pastel landscapes by Ann Bernauer, exquisite orchid paintings by MaryAnn Nardo, a special still life treat by Sachal, peaceful floral and Sonoma hills landscapes by Jill Keller-Peters. digitally enhanced photos by Peter Fronk, black & white photography by Stephen Palmer, a powerful lime stone sculpture by Elmer Kurtek, the spectacular earrings by Denise Ward and special holiday season pendants by Ellaine Kendell.

The artists will also be available during the Downtown Open House on December 1st from 1 – 4 pm and from 5 – 8 pm during the Holiday Art Walk on Friday, December 14th. Pelican Art Gallery is located at 143 Petaluma Blvd North, next to Della Fattoria, just north of Putnam Plaza. Hours are Tues – Thurs 10am -6pm, Fri 10am – 8pm and Sat/Sun 11am – 5pm.
